Below are common methods that people always use to cloak or hide affiliate links.
Method 1: By using Tiny URL
To use this method, you can simply log on to http://tinyurl.com , enter your affiliate link in the box and you are ready to go. This method is just to avoid visitors recognize your link each time they hover the mouse. However, they can easily found that you gain commission as a Clickbank affiliate once they click on the link and see the address bar. For example like productwebsite.com/index.php?hop=yourclickbankid.
However, I found that some Clickbank merchants already eliminate this ugly hop issue.
This method is useful to cloak a link when sending promotional emails, or to be inserted into your website.
Method 2: By using iframe
This method requires you to have your own domain and hosting. Your visitors will see yourwebsite.com/product, in the address bar, instead of
productwebsite.com/index.php?hop=yourclickbankid.
To use this method, copy the following code to notepad, and replace the YOUR-AFFILIATE-LINK-HERE with your real affiliate link. PRODUCT NAME HERE with the product name you are promoting.
<html>
<head><title>PRODUCT NAME HERE.</title></head>
<frameset border="0">
<frame src="YOUR-AFFILIATE-LINK-HERE" frameborder="no">
<noframes>
Sorry, it appears you are using a Web browser thatdoes not support frames.
</noframes>
</frameset>
</html>
Save the notepad file into a .html file. For example cloak.html. Then, upload this file to your server. When someone click on the link, he will see yourwebsite.com/cloak.html. See example.
However, when people see the page source, (Press Ctrl + U for Firefox), they will able to see your affiliate link. 80% visitors won’t do this anyway, unless if they already know this method.

This method is useful when you are including affiliate link in
- promotional emails.
- your website
- the articles and bio box when you submit articles to Ezine Articles or Hubpages. These websites don’t allow affiliate links, but they allow you to include your website links which is directed to affiliate link.
